CARSTAR President Dan Bailey to Step Down from Corporate Role, Pursue Ownership in the CARSTAR Franchise System

OVERLAND PARK, Kan. – CARSTAR Auto Body Repair Experts has announced that Dan Bailey has chosen to step down from his current position as president.
 
After running family collision repair centers for nearly 23 years, the Baileys sold their stores to CARSTAR in 1998 and Dan Bailey joined the CARSTAR corporate team. Since then, he has played a key role in the operational management and improvements for the company’s franchises and corporate-owned stores and has become a highly regarded figure in the industry.
 
Going forward, Bailey has expressed interest in taking a well-deserved break and then returning to own and run future CARSTAR Auto Body Repair centers. He will continue to serve as a member of the Mitchell Advisory Board, on the CCC Advisory Board, as a national judge for Skills USA – VICA and as a participant in the Collision Industry Conference (CIC).
 
“Dan Bailey has been a great business partner, a great asset to our company and our franchisees, a great role model and a great friend,” said Dick Cross, chairman and CEO for CARSTAR Auto Body Repair Experts.
 
“Dan has helped us put in place the strongest platform in our industry for independent owners who want to succeed in today’s demanding collision repair environment, and who want to continue to own and run their stores. We wish Dan and his family all the very best and look forward to continuing our relationship – just under a different framework.”
 
Bailey will transition his responsibilities over the coming months. No replacement is expected for his position. Stacy Bartnik will assume full responsibility for franchise services. Other recent hires at CARSTAR will allow Dick Cross to take over certain other responsibilities, the company said.
